Web mining based extraction of problem solution ideas
Authors:D Thorleuchter  D Van den Poel
Affiliation:1. Fraunhofer INT, D-53879 Euskirchen, Appelsgarten 2, Germany;2. Ghent University, B-9000 Gent, Tweekerkenstraat 2, Belgium
Abstract:The internet is a valuable source of information where many ideas can be found dealing with different topics. A few numbers of ideas might be able to solve an existing problem. However, it is time-consuming to identify these ideas within the large amount of textual information in the internet. This paper introduces a new web mining approach that enables an automated identification of new technological ideas extracted from internet sources that are able to solve a given problem. It adapts and combines several existing approaches from literature: approaches that extract new technological ideas from a user given text, approaches that investigate the different idea characteristics in different technical domains, and multi-language web mining approaches. In contrast to previous work, the proposed approach enables the identification of problem solution ideas in the internet considering domain dependencies and language aspects. In a case study, new ideas are identified to solve existing technological problems as occurred in research and development (R&D) projects. This supports the process of research planning and technology development.
